Kalahari Gemsbok Park - Kgalagadi Transfrontier Park

OFF THE TOURIST TRACK - FOR THE TRUE ADVENTURER
This is the last unspoiled wilderness, remote, raw, wild - stunning vistas of terra cotta dunes against a cobalt blue sky. Kalahari lions, cheetahs hunting, various smaller predators, the famous meerkats, gemsbok and springbok etc. Amazing bird life. For the wildlife connoisseur... a must! No elephant, rhino or buffalo here, but a huge and fascinating collection of creatures you won't find anywhere else. Surely the best cats in any park.
This world famous park now combined with Botswana's Gemsbok Park is called the Kgalagadi Transfrontier Park and is one of the largest parks in the world. Situated +-1000kms from Johannesburg and Cape Town, and bordering Namibia and Botswana. En route to the park, marvel at the vast spaces and solitude, the endless rolling farms and huge sociable weaver nests.
This is the home of the Nama people, descendants of the famous original hunter/gatherer people, the San. You may be lucky enough to encounter some of these fascinating gazelle-like people who still cling to their traditional ways.

Etosha Park Namibia

Brilliant game watching at waterholes in this world famous park
This world famous park is situated on a salt pan with fabulous concentrations of antelope, elephant, lion, black rhino, Damara dik-dik, and blackfaced impala. This park offers absolutely brilliant opportunities for game watching at water holes in addition to normal game driving. There are very few parks that can offer such an amazing kaleidoscope of animals coming and going to the waterholes.
Etosha park is situated in Namibia, the home to the Herero and Himba peoples. The capital of Namibia is Windhoek, an elegant, orderly city where you may start or end your journey. The drive from Windhoek to Etosha takes about 5 hours. Passing vast stock farms - a landscape both harsh and breathtakingly beautiful. The name 'Namibia' means "a place of great and arid plains".
Be advised that during the summer rainfall season, i.e. mid November to February, the elephant move away, so you will not be guaranteed sightings of them at that time. Also, December / January is very busy as it is school holiday time.

Hluhluwe Umfolozi National Parks

The BIG 5, cheetah, wild dogs, many antelope and magnificent bird viewing can be found in the scenic, verdant KwaZulu Natal rolling hillsides in tropical rain forest type vegetation.
These two famous parks are interlinked and situated some +- 600kms south of Johannesburg and Swaziland - a scenic 7.5 hour drive from Johannesburg. This is the land of the famous Zulu warrior Chaka Zulu and the Zulu people. Durban is the closest city - a short 2 hour drive away.
